Arab Food Security Conference Issues Range of Recommendations |
Beirut, 7 February 2012 (UN Information Service) – Participants in an international conference on Arab food security today concluded two days of meetings with a call to highlight the need to focus on supporting job-creating growth for the poor in countries with household-level food insecurity, and on encouraging exports to finance food imports and agriculture in countries with macro-level food insecurity. |

Sultanate of Oman Provides Financial Support to UN-ESCWA Development Projects and Technical Cooperation Activities |
The Sultanate of Oman today provided UN-ESCWA with financial support of USD 50,000 to fund development projects and technical cooperation and support activities for member countries. The Sultanate is considered one of the most prominent supporters of UN-ESCWA in recent years since it has already provided funds that amounted to USD 300,000. |

ESCWA 30th Ministerial Session to take place in Beirut with focus on technology for sustainable development |
Beirut, 31 May 2018 (Communication and Information Unit)--The Economic and Social Commission for Western Asia (ESCWA) today announced it will hold its 30th Ministerial Session in Beirut, Lebanon on 27 and 28 June with a focus on technology for sustainable development. “We are proud to welcome the Ministerial Session back to Beirut this year, as the last one organized in Lebanon was in 2012,” said Mohamed Ali Alhakim, the Executive Secretary of ESCWA. |

ESCWA Promotes Transport Emission Reductions |
ESCWA today opened a meeting of regional and international experts to discuss the main aspects of the transport sector, its emissions and their impact on climate change. Entitled “Promoting Emissions Reductions in the Transport Sector,” the 5-6 July meeting is held at the UN House in Beirut in cooperation with the Gas Center of the United Nations Economic Commission for Europe (UNECE). |

UNCTAD-UNESCWA Workshop to Develop Country Decision-Makers |
A second joint regional training course designed by the United Nations Conference on Trade and Development (UNCTAD) and UNESCWA, on “Key Issues on the International Economic Agenda” is due to begin at the UN House, Beirut, on 26 June 2006. The course will be jointly opened by UNESCWA Deputy Executive Secretary Atif Kubursi and UNCTAD Deputy Secretary-General Dirk Bruinsma at 9:00am. |
